HitTestOptions 列挙型

定義

ビジュアル スタイルで指定された背景でヒット テストを実行するときに使用できるオプションを指定します。

この列挙体は、メンバー値のビットごとの組み合わせをサポートしています。

public enum class HitTestOptions
[System.Flags]
public enum HitTestOptions
[<System.Flags>]
type HitTestOptions = 
Public Enum HitTestOptions
継承
HitTestOptions
属性

フィールド

名前 説明
BackgroundSegment 0

バックグラウンド セグメントのヒット テスト オプション。

FixedBorder 2

固定罫線のヒット テスト オプション。

Caption 4

キャプションのヒット テスト オプション。

ResizingBorderLeft 16

左のサイズ変更罫線のヒット テスト オプション。

ResizingBorderTop 32

上のサイズ変更罫線のヒット テスト オプション。

ResizingBorderRight 64

右のサイズ変更罫線のヒット テスト オプション。

ResizingBorderBottom 128

下のサイズ変更罫線のヒット テスト オプション。

ResizingBorder 240

サイズ変更の境界線のヒット テスト オプション。

SizingTemplate 256

サイズ変更の境界線は、ウィンドウの端だけでなく、テンプレートとして指定されます。 このオプションは、 SystemSizingMarginsと相互に排他的です。 SizingTemplate が優先されます。

SystemSizingMargins 512

システムのサイズ変更罫線の幅は、ビジュアル スタイルのコンテンツ余白の代わりに使用されます。 このオプションは、 SizingTemplateと相互に排他的です。 SizingTemplate が優先されます。

注釈

HitTestOptions値は、VisualStyleRenderer.HitTestBackground メソッドの引数として使用されます。

適用対象